Compliance and Best Practices in Insurance Telemarketing Campaigns
Compliance is paramount in insurance telemarketing campaigns. Strict regulations govern customer contact. Adhering to these rules protects both consumers and businesses. Data privacy laws are critically important. These include GDPR, CCPA, and similar frameworks. Agents must understand consent requirements fully. They must handle personal information securely. Call recordings often require explicit permission. Opt-out requests must be honored immediately. Maintaining a Do Not Call list is mandatory. Regular audits ensure ongoing compliance. Legal counsel reviews all calling scripts. This prevents misrepresentation or false claims. Ethical conduct guides every interaction. Transparency builds strong consumer trust.
